Nestled in the Mayacamas, Mount Veeder is a hidden gem where volcanic soils cradle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, and Zinfandel. The cool winds and sunny days nurture bold, complex wines, featuring dark fruits, hints of eucalyptus, and a velvety finish. With a rich historical tapestry of winemaking, this micro-region invites connoisseurs to explore its captivating depths.
